Other

  • Design review required

    New construction shall be subject to Design Review as required by Pasadena Municipal Code Section 17.61.030 Design Review.

  • Ground floor housing is prohibited along Fair Oaks Avenue. The ground floor along Fair Oaks Avenue shall be limited to pedestrian-oriented uses classified under "Retail Uses" and "Services" that are identified in Table II Allowable Land Uses and Permit Requirements and shall have a minimum depth of 40 feet.

  • Primary - Holly Plaza shall be a minimum of 35,000 square feet in area with a minimum linear frontage of 200 feet along Holly Street and a minimum depth of 50 feet at any location. Twenty percent of the plaza area dedicated to plantings.

  • Minimum of 200 square feet of usable open space per residential unit, of which up to 50 percent, or up to 100 square feet, may be provided as a balcony or similar area only available to the occupant of the residential unit.

  • There shall be a maximum of 630,000 square feet of new commercial floor area.

  • New construction shall not exceed 1.191 million square feet of floor area, including 630,000 square feet of commercial uses and 561,000 square feet of residential uses.

  • Up to 22,500 square feet of floor area may be used for retail uses.

  • New construction shall not exceed 1.191 million square feet of floor area, including 630,000 square feet of commercial uses and 561,000 square feet of residential uses.

  • A minimum of 65 percent of the usable open space, excluding balconies/patios/terraces, would be located outdoors; and courtyards shall comprise a minimum of 25 percent of the total usable open space and each courtyard shall be a minimum of 400 square feet in area with a minimum dimension in any direction of 15 feet, with at least 25 percent of the courtyard area being dedicated to plantings.

From the ordinance

There shall be a maximum of 475 residential units. There shall be a maximum of 630,000 square feet of new commercial floor area. The PD shall not exceed an overall 2.15 maximum FAR. The maximum lot coverage shall not exceed 65 percent of the total land area.
